Output 6598ab831e788590ff573080f1557b977d0fc1472488c777a34235da27e866d7:63

value
95713
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2526d2035ec89cda0140d4b468277b817dd50eb2 OP_EQUAL
address
355TRvksbiDE1bAW5ejPKLyi7StnMFpsrn
transaction
6598ab831e788590ff573080f1557b977d0fc1472488c777a34235da27e866d7
spent
true